package ptolemy.graph.analysis.strategy;

import java.util.ArrayList;
import java.util.Collections;
import java.util.Iterator;
import java.util.List;

import ptolemy.graph.DirectedGraph;
import ptolemy.graph.Graph;
import ptolemy.graph.Node;
import ptolemy.graph.analysis.analyzer.SourceNodeAnalyzer;

//////////////////////////////////////////////////////////////////////////
//// SourceNodeAnalysis

/**
Computation of source nodes in a graph.
The collection returned cannot be modified.
<p>
This analysis requires <em>O</em>(<em>N</em>) time, where <em>N</em> is the
number of nodes in the graph.
<p>
@see ptolemy.graph.analysis.SourceNodeAnalysis
@since Ptolemy II 4.0
@Pt.ProposedRating Red (shahrooz)
@Pt.AcceptedRating Red (ssb)
@author Ming Yung Ko, Shahrooz Shahparnia
@version $Id: SourceNodeStrategy.java,v 1.13 2005/07/08 19:59:05 cxh Exp $
*/
public class SourceNodeStrategy extends CachedStrategy implements
        SourceNodeAnalyzer {
    /** Construct an instance of this strategy for a given graph.
     *
     *  @param graph The given graph.
     */
    public SourceNodeStrategy(Graph graph) {
        super(graph);
    }

    ///////////////////////////////////////////////////////////////////
    ////                         public methods                    ////

    /** Compute the source nodes in the graph in the form of
     *  a collection. Each element of the collection is a {@link Node}.
     *
     *  @return The source nodes.
     */
    public List nodes() {
        return (List) _result();
    }

    /** Return a description of the analyzer.
     *
     *  @return Return a description of the analyzer..
     */
    public String toString() {
        return "Ordinary Source-loop analyzer.\n";
    }

    /** Check compatibility of the class of graph. The given graph
     *  must be an instance of DirectedGraph.
     *
     *  @param graph The given graph.
     *  @return True if the given graph is of class DirectedGraph.
     */
    public boolean valid() {
        return (graph() instanceof DirectedGraph);
    }

    ///////////////////////////////////////////////////////////////////
    ////                         protected methods                 ////

    /** Compute the source nodes in the graph in the form of
     *  a collection. Each element of the collection is a {@link Node}.
     *
     *  @return The source nodes.
     */
    protected Object _compute() {
        ArrayList sourceNodes = new ArrayList();
        Iterator nodes = graph().nodes().iterator();

        while (nodes.hasNext()) {
            Node node = (Node) nodes.next();

            if (((DirectedGraph) graph()).inputEdgeCount(node) == 0) {
                sourceNodes.add(node);
            }
        }

        return sourceNodes;
    }

    /** Return the result of this analysis (collection of source nodes)
     *  in a form that cannot be modified.
     *
     *  @return The analysis result in unmodifiable form.
     */
    protected Object _convertResult() {
        return Collections.unmodifiableList((List) _result());
    }
}
